ALK Global Fair Event Gate and bag checks (Unarmed Card) ALK Global Security Solutions - 3.2 Ridgefield, WA Job Details Part-time | Full-time $20 - $22 an hour 1 day ago Qualifications Outdoor work Professional ethics Driver's License Guard Card Security Event customer service Full Job Description We are seeking vigilant, reliable, and proactive Event Security Guards to join our team for the Clark County Fair in Ridgefield, WA. In this role, you will be on the front lines of safety, playing a crucial part in maintaining a secure, orderly, and enjoyable environment for all attendees, vendors, and staff. This role requires a dependable professional who can problem-solve with high integrity, interact courteously with the public, and maintain a calm, alert presence under pressure.
Key Responsibilities Gate & Bag Check Operations:
Conduct thorough and courteous security screenings at entry gates, ensuring prohibited items do not enter the fairgrounds.
Access Control & Monitoring:
Enforce strict badge verification and visitor sign-ins at restricted areas and designated checkpoints.
Patrol Duties:
Conduct regular foot patrols of assigned areas, monitoring both static posts and roving assignments to deter incidents and identify potential hazards.
De-escalation & Conflict Resolution:
Utilize verbal de-escalation techniques to handle public inquiries, defuse tense situations calmly, and professionally maintain order.
Alcohol Monitoring:
Monitor designated checkpoints and consumption areas to ensure compliance with fair policies and Washington state legal regulations.
Emergency Response:
Respond promptly and effectively to safety hazards or emergencies, acting lawfully and decisively under the direction of management.
Incident Reporting:
Alert leadership to signs of disorder or policy violations, and assist in documenting accurate, professional incident details.
Requirements Experience:
Minimum of 1-2 years of experience in security, customer service, or public-facing roles is preferred, but a strong work ethic and reliability are paramount.
Guard Card:
Must possess a current and active Washington Unarmed Guard Card (Required).
Core Competencies:
Strong communication skills, ability to remain calm in high-stress situations, and an uncompromised standard of personal integrity.
Physical Ability:
Must be physically capable of standing, walking, and maintaining an alert presence for extended periods (8-12 hour shifts) in an outdoor environment.
Transportation:
Must have access to reliable personal transportation to and from the fairgrounds in Ridgefield, WA.
Availability:
Must have completely open availability for the full duration of the fair assignment (including weekdays, weekends, and late nights).
